It’ll End in Tears, and Vetoes

Summary by thevpo.org
Well, that blew up in Senate leadership’s face, thoroughly and decisively. As reported by Vermont Public’s Lola Duffort, the senior chamber’s version of H.454, the education reform bill, has been indefinitely sidelined due to an embarrassing lack of support. Specifically, support among the Democratic majority. President Pro Term (With Egg On Face) Phil Baruth: “I made a promise to people in the caucus that I wouldn’t bring a bill that had a lit…
